Salvadora persica miswak chewing stick chewing sticks though the term may be a misnomer considering that the stick is chewed only briefly to fray the fibers which is then used as a brush are obtained from a variety of plant species and have been traditionally used for cleaning teeth in africa asia latin america and the near east.
